Effilogics Technologies

Effilogics Technologies

effiCIENCIA ENERGETICA | SOFTWARE DE GESTION ENERGETICA.

Launch date
Employees
Market cap
-
Enterprise valuation
CAD2—2m (Dealroom.co estimates Dec 2013.)
Company register number B65705329
Barcelona Catalonia (HQ & founding location)
Authorizing premium user...